0
Skip to Content
Crown and Chance
Home
About
How To Enter
FAQ
Shop
Contact
Crown and Chance
Home
About
How To Enter
FAQ
Shop
Contact
Home
About
How To Enter
FAQ
Shop
Contact

Crown & Chance

71-75 Shelton Street
Covent Garden, London, UK
WC2H 9JQ

info@crownandchance.com

Terms & Conditions

Privacy Policy